I am trying to create a document with two separate "tickets" within it, each within their own column. As a mail merge attempt, I have duplicate tickets with the same fields out of a simple Calc database and want to have record 1 fields in the first ticket, and record 2 fields in the second ticket and so on through the mail merge. If I do a straight copy, I get the same records as the next record comes at the end of the document or page (only one in this case). However, I did what I thought was correct in adding the Next Record field before the start of the second ticket (Insert -> Field -> Other -> Database - > Next Record). The problem occurs that when I go through the mail merge process it appears to be fine until I get to preview the records and then the second ticket loses all field content. I can see a thin grey field line there, but there is no content and I cannot edit them?

Details that may be of importance - I am using version 2.3 under Mac OS X 10.4 operating system (PPC). I also included the fields within individual frames out of necessity for formatting. Any ideas of what is happening here? Is this a bug?
